CARLOS “CALOY” YULO didn’t win gold at the Liverpool World Artistic Gymnastics World Championships and settled for a silver in vault and bronze in parallel bars.“I was beaten by myself,” the 22-year-old Yulo told Filipino reporters in an online interview on Monday morning. “I didn’t notice those things around my surroundings. It took a toll on me.”
In vault, he was a tad short of retaining the gold he won at last year’s worlds in Kitakyushu. He also missed retaining silver in the bars. Radivilov later told a wires interview that the Kyiv-based Ukrainian team were forced to train during daylight hours because of “difficulties” over the availability of electricity in the evening because of Russia’s ongoing conflict with his country.
“I wasn’t expecting anything from the parallel bars because my score was really low,” Yulo said. “I was really happy in vault despite finishing second because my routine was really new and I managed to pull it off.”
